Comprehending Counterfeit Money


Counterfeit money describes currency that is produced without the legal sanction of the federal government, simulating real banknotes. This illicit money is typically created to defraud people, businesses, and banks. The counterfeiting of currency is not a new phenomenon; it has actually existed for centuries, adapting to technological modifications and evolving methods of detection.

The Origin of Counterfeit Money

Counterfeit currency originates from various sources. Historically, individuals would handcraft replicas of legal tender, but improvements in printing innovation have caused a more sophisticated production process. Today's counterfeiters frequently utilize high-quality printing methods and materials that carefully look like the initial currency.

The Legal Ramifications


Among the most essential aspects to comprehend is the legal implications of engaging with counterfeit currency. Acquiring, possessing, or dispersing counterfeit money is a serious crime in practically every nation. The charges can range from significant fines to lengthy prison sentences. Here's a breakdown of the legal problems included:

  1. Possession: Simply having counterfeit money is illegal and can result in serious penalties.
  2. Distribution: Selling or distributing counterfeit currency elevates the intensity of the criminal offense, resulting in harsher repercussions.
  3. Intent to Defraud: Even attempting to use counterfeit notes, no matter successful transactions, can cause criminal charges.

How can I report counterfeit currency?

If you experience counterfeit currency, you must report it to your regional law enforcement firm or the Secret Service in the United States. They investigate counterfeit money and can supply assistance.

Exist any educational resources on counterfeit money?

Yes, organizations such as the U.S. Secret Service and numerous banks offer substantial materials on how to identify and handle counterfeit currency.
